in Slough
Car Park Operators
Is this your business? Claim now!Brunel Way, Slough Station- West Railway Terrace, Slough, SL1 1XW
Car Manufacturers
Is this your business? Claim now!1 Stoke Gardens, SLOUGH, Berkshire, SL1 3QB
Car Accessories and Parts
Is this your business? Claim now!Balfour Business Centre, Balfour Road, Southall, London, United Kingdom, UB2 5BD
D2P Autoparts based in London United Kingdom(UK). The company was founded in 2010 by three siblings, with respective backgrounds...
Car Parts, Inter Coolers, Strut Mounts, Cooling Fans, Drop Link, Power Steering Pump, Engine Mounts, Wiper Blades, Wheel Bearing Kits, Fuel Pumps, Crankshafts, Throttle Bodies, Air Flow Mass Meter, EGR Valves, Heater Blowers, Propshaft, Steering and Suspension Parts, Door Lock Mechanisms and Parts, Air Suspension Parts, Turbo Hoses
Telecommunications Installation
Is this your business? Claim now!244 High Street, Slough, Berkshire, SL1 1JU
Car Park Operators
North Orbital Road, London, UB9 5ES
Car Park Denham Station | APCOA is a secure high quality Car Park located in London. Find our more information on tariff...
address, apcoa, apcoa parking, car park, car park near me, cheap parking, day parking, opening times, overnight parking, parking, parking near me, prebooking, prices, season tickets, secure parking, weekend parking